As Donald Trump took the oath of office on Jan. 20, he was flanked by some of the world’s wealthiest people. The billionaires present that day — including Elon Musk, Jeff Bezos and Mark Zuckerberg — had never been richer, flush with big gains from frothy stock markets.
Summary
Since Trump’s second-term inauguration, five top billionaires have lost a combined $209 billion as markets react to policy uncertainty.
Elon Musk’s net worth plunged $148 billion as Tesla shares collapsed amid declining European and Chinese sales.
Jeff Bezos lost $29 billion as Amazon stock fell 14%.
Sergey Brin’s fortune dropped $22 billion following Alphabet’s weak earnings and regulatory pressure.
Mark Zuckerberg and Bernard Arnault each lost $5 billion as Meta and LVMH stocks tumbled.
The S&P 500 is down 6.4%, reversing gains seen post-election.
